VISA & POST-STUDY WORK

Visa pathway for United Kingdom

Student Visa Student Route

The UK Student visa covers your full course at a licensed sponsor institution, with defined part-time work rights.

  • Course must be at an eligible UK Student sponsor institution
  • English requirement usually met via IELTS/UKVI-approved test
  • Dependant visas now largely restricted to government-sponsored or specific postgraduate courses
  • From 25 Feb 2026, most visa-free visitors need a UK ETA to enter

💼 Post-Study Work Graduate Route

The Graduate Route lets you stay and work (or look for work) after your degree, without needing employer sponsorship.

  • 2 years for Bachelor's/Master's graduates — if you apply on or before 31 December 2026
  • Reduces to 18 months for applications made on or after 1 January 2027
  • PhD graduates keep the full 3-year allowance, unaffected by this change
  • Cannot be extended — plan your switch to Skilled Worker or another route in advance

2026 Policy Update — Confirm Before You Apply

This is the single most time-sensitive visa change across all our destinations: the UK Graduate Route shortens from 2 years to 18 months for any application made on or after 1 January 2027. If you can realistically complete your course and apply for the Graduate Route before that date — which favours a September/October 2026 intake for a one-year Master's — you lock in the full 2-year window. We build your intake plan around this deadline specifically.

TIMING

Intake calendar

September Intake

Primary intake

Full range of courses; most scholarships and halls of residence available.

January Intake

Secondary intake

Offered by many universities for select programs.

May Intake

Limited programs

A few universities and foundation courses only.
